Output 076f530e9936c24705ec40e2d444c86d9d29d801b6d2664357f752ad5277e9be:0

value
1918253
script pubkey
OP_0 OP_PUSHBYTES_20 ba2fb88c27fb047c329428ec0ffd412ca7f091e5
address
bc1qhghm3rp8lvz8cv559rkqll2p9jnlpy09e4e52r
transaction
076f530e9936c24705ec40e2d444c86d9d29d801b6d2664357f752ad5277e9be
confirmations
139654
spent
true